Tour Checklist

Key items to inspect during your property tour

Inspect the quality of the 'gutted to the studs' renovation by checking for level floors, square door frames, and smooth wall finishes, especially in areas that might have been overlooked.

Inspect the solar panel installation for proper mounting, wiring, and any signs of damage or wear. Request documentation of the system's age, warranty, and energy production history.

Inspect the 'upgraded plumbing' by running all faucets and showers simultaneously to check for adequate water pressure and drainage. Look for any signs of leaks or water damage under sinks and around toilets.

Examine the 'updated electrical' system by checking the electrical panel for proper labeling, sufficient amperage, and any signs of overheating or corrosion. Test multiple outlets simultaneously to ensure adequate power supply.
